About 2 miles from Inverness are the Culloden Battlefields. As I hadn't been there yet, I paid a visit. It's quite eerily quiet - I can't quite describe it. There is a new visitors centre there, which is brilliant. You are inundated with history and information on the Battle of Culloden, and there is a video room where the screens are on all 4 walls, so it is like you are in the middle of the battle - really well done. They do walking tours throughout the day, but as I was in a bit of a hurry, I went myself. What I didn't realise is that if you walk round the battlefield yourself, they issue you with headphones, explaining all the different significant areas. I didn't realise until I was far away from the visitor centre and had passed a couple of people with the aforementioned headphones. I was quite happy just reading all the info round the field anyway, but I'm sure with the headphones it would have been better - oh, and I failed to mention - I went round the wrong way, which was quite embarrassing. I realised after passing a few people and the order in which I was reading, that you're supposed to go round the battlefield in a clockwise direction - ooops! It was very interesting nonetheless.
